About this day nursery

Walmgate Day Nursery is a family-owned childcare facility situated in the centre of York, offering a nurturing and stimulating environment for children aged three months to five years. The nursery is divided into three age-specific rooms: Diddies (0-2 years), Explorers (2-3 years), and Adventurers (3-5 years), in addition to an activity room and a small outdoor play area.

Emphasising individual learning styles, the nursery provides a wealth of open-ended resources to encourage discovery and exploration. Beyond the indoor setting, Walmgate Day Nursery capitalises on its central location by regularly taking children on educational excursions around York, visiting cultural and historical landmarks like York Minster and the National Railway Museum, effectively extending the classroom into the vibrant city.

The dedicated team of qualified professionals, all trained in paediatric first aid, are committed to providing personalised care and fostering each child's development. The nursery welcomes government-funded places, ensuring high-quality childcare is accessible without additional costs for meals, activities, or resources.

Inspector highlights

  • Managers have focused on addressing the weaknesses found in the last inspection.
  • The key-person system is effective. Staff know the children that they care for well.
  • Children learn about their bodies and what their body parts do.
  • Staff read familiar stories to children. They repeat stories so that children learn them.
  • Staff and managers consider how funding can be used to meet individual children's needs.

Areas to develop

  • 1support staff to engage in more in-depth conversations with children to further develop their conversational skills
  • 2provide further support for staff to develop their teaching skills so that there is consistency of the quality of teaching across all staff.

SEND provision

Staff and managers consider how funding can be used to meet individual children's needs. They purchase resources that help children to practise taking turns. They provide experiences, such as music sessions, to help develop children's confidence and self-esteem.
